Child Rebel Soldier, or CRS, is a musical group comprised of hip hop artists Kanye West, Pharrell Williams and Lupe Fiasco. Their first single, "Us Placers", appeared on Kanye West's mixtape, "Can't Tell Me Nothing" released in May 2007.[1] To date, the members have not decided whether CRS will exist beyond "Us Placers," but they have not dismissed the idea.[2] "Everyone's focused on something else at the moment," Lupe recently explained in an interview with Pitchfork. "[We're trying to find] two or three weeks to sit down and hammer it out."[3] The song "Us Placers" was #43 on Rolling Stone's list of the 100 Best Songs of 2007.[4] According to an interview on sohh.com with Lupe Fiasco, there are plans for a CRS album in late 2008.
